#7bbe82 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7bbe82 is composed of 48.2% red, 74.5%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.6%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 126.3 degrees, a saturation of 34% and a lightness of 61.4%. #7bbe82 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#007d05.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#7bbe82

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d07 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7bbe82

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99a09a is the less saturated color, while #3efb52 is the most saturated one.
